Cat doors can be found in numerous designs, ranging from easy flap doors to electronic models that just permit signed up family pets to go through. The type of cat door picked considerably affects both the overall cost and installation difficulty.

Kinds Of Cat Doors:
TypeDescriptionTypical Cost (GBP)Traditional Flap DoorStandard installation, often made of plastic or wood.₤ 20 - ₤ 50magnetic cat flap installation Flap DoorFunctions magnets to keep the flap close.₤ 25 - ₤ 75Electronic Cat DoorUtilizes a microchip or an essential fob to enable gain access to.₤ 150 - ₤ 500Wall-Mounted DoorInstalled through a wall rather than a door.₤ 100 - ₤ 3002. Factors Influencing Installation Costs
A number of aspects add to the installation prices of cat doors, consisting of:
Type of Cat Door: More sophisticated doors, like electronic designs, normally need more detailed installation.Installation Site: Installing a door on a strong wood door typically costs less than installing one on a wall.Home Design: Older or distinctively developed homes may introduce extra challenges for installation, causing increased costs.Labor Costs: Geographic place and need in your location will affect the per hour rates of installers.Additional Features: Features such as security locks or weather condition sealing will add to the total cost.3. Average Costs of Cat Door Installation
The table listed below illustrates the average costs included in working with a professional to set up a innovative cat flap installer door.
Service IncludedTypical Cost (GBP)Basic Installation (Flap Door)₤ 100 - ₤ 200Complex Installation (Wall, Electronic)₤ 200 - ₤ 500Additional Custom Features₤ 25 - ₤ 50 per featureRemoval of Existing Door₤ 50 - ₤ 150Cost of Materials₤ 20 - ₤ 1004. The Price Breakdown of Cat Door Installation
A detailed price breakdown can help potential pet owners comprehend what to expect regarding cat door installation costs.

Initial Consultation: An assessment fee frequently ranges from ₤ 20 to ₤ 50, depending upon whether you need the service to advise on door choice or installation strategy.

Products: The typical cost of products can vary, specifically if you have particular options (like vinyl, wood, or personalized functions). Expect to pay between ₤ 20 and ₤ 100 for materials.

Labor Costs: The per hour labor rate for specialists can v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 80, depending upon the complexity of the installation and your geographical location.

Various Add-Ons: If you require extra functions, such as weather stripping or customized framing, the costs can add ₤ 25 to ₤ 50 per improvement.

Frequently asked questions
Q1: Can I set up a cat door myself to save money?A1: Yes, many pet owners select to set up cat doors as a DIY job. Nevertheless, remember that this needs some general handyman abilities, and improper installation might result in problems down the roadway. Q2: Are there any specific authorizations needed for installing a cat door?A2: Generally, many homes do not require authorizations for cat door installation, but it's important to inspect local building regulations, specifically for wall installations. Q3: How do I pick the ideal size for my cat door?A3: Measure your cat's height and width to ensure that the door you select will accommodate their size easily, usually enabling a few additional inches for ease of gain access to.
